Top 5 Best 70634 Louisiana Public Elementary Schools (2025)

For the 2025 school year, there are 6 public elementary schools serving 2,546 students in 70634, LA.
The top ranked public elementary schools in 70634, LA are East Beauregard Elementary School, Pine Wood Elementary School and Deridder Junior High School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public elementary schools in zipcode 70634 have an average math proficiency score of 34% (versus the Louisiana public elementary school average of 32%), and reading proficiency score of 34% (versus the 42% statewide average). Elementary schools in 70634, LA have an average ranking of 5/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Louisiana public elementary schools.
Minority enrollment is 33% of the student body (majority Black), which is less than the Louisiana public elementary school average of 59% (majority Black).
